Authorities are investigating a fire that claimed the life of a man in a Highbridge apartment building Monday.

According to the NYPD, at 10:18 p.m. on Feb. 20, police and fire personnel responded to a 911 call of a fire at 1133 Ogden Ave., a 24-story apartment building. The fire had broken out inside an apartment on the 24th floor.

After firefighters extinguished the flames, a 45-year-old man was found unconscious inside the apartment. The victim, whose identity has not been released, was rushed to NYC Health & Hospitals/ Lincoln, where he was pronounced dead.

Inside the apartment, officials also found a 46-year-old woman, a 15-year-old boy and an 11-month-old boy with non-life-threatening injuries. They were all taken to NYC Health & Hospitals/ Harlem in stable condition.

The FDNY Fire Marshal’s office will determine the cause of the fire. The investigation remains ongoing.
